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 __construct()

Monolog\Handler\SlackHandler::__construct (   $token,
  $channel,
  $username = 'Monolog',
  $useAttachment = true,
  $iconEmoji = null,
  $level = Logger::CRITICAL,
  $bubble = true,
  $useShortAttachment = false,
  $includeContextAndExtra = false 
)
Parameters
string$tokenSlack API token
string$channelSlack channel (encoded ID or name)
string$usernameName of a bot
bool$useAttachmentWhether the message should be added to Slack as attachment (plain text otherwise)
string | null$iconEmojiThe emoji name to use (or null)
int$levelThe minimum logging level at which this handler will be triggered
bool$bubbleWhether the messages that are handled can bubble up the stack or not
bool$useShortAttachmentWhether the the context/extra messages added to Slack as attachments are in a short style
bool$includeContextAndExtraWhether the attachment should include context and extra data
Exceptions
MissingExtensionExceptionIf no OpenSSL PHP extension configured

Definition at line 84 of file SlackHandler.php.

85 {
86 if (!extension_loaded('openssl')) {
87 throw new MissingExtensionException('The OpenSSL PHP extension is required to use the SlackHandler');
88 }
89
90 parent::__construct('ssl://slack.com:443', $level, $bubble);
91
92 $this->token = $token;
93 $this->channel = $channel;
94 $this->username = $username;
95 $this->iconEmoji = trim($iconEmoji, ':');
96 $this->useAttachment = $useAttachment;
97 $this->useShortAttachment = $useShortAttachment;
98 $this->includeContextAndExtra = $includeContextAndExtra;
99
100 if ($this->includeContextAndExtra && $this->useShortAttachment) {
101 $this->lineFormatter = new LineFormatter;
102 }
103 }

◆ getAttachmentColor()

Monolog\Handler\SlackHandler::getAttachmentColor (   $level)
protected

Returned a Slack message attachment color associated with provided level.

Parameters
int$level
Returns
string

Definition at line 264 of file SlackHandler.php.

265 {
266 switch (true) {
267 case $level >= Logger::ERROR:
268 return 'danger';
269 case $level >= Logger::WARNING:
270 return 'warning';
271 case $level >= Logger::INFO:
272 return 'good';
273 default:
274 return '#e3e4e6';
275 }
276 }

◆ prepareContentData()

Monolog\Handler\SlackHandler::prepareContentData (   $record)
protected

Prepares content data.

Parameters
array$record
Returns
array

Definition at line 137 of file SlackHandler.php.

138 {
139 $dataArray = array(
140 'token' => $this->token,
141 'channel' => $this->channel,
142 'username' => $this->username,
143 'text' => '',
144 'attachments' => array(),
145 );
146
147 if ($this->formatter) {
148 $message = $this->formatter->format($record);
149 } else {
150 $message = $record['message'];
151 }
152
153 if ($this->useAttachment) {
154 $attachment = array(
155 'fallback' => $message,
156 'color' => $this->getAttachmentColor($record['level']),
157 'fields' => array(),
158 );
159
160 if ($this->useShortAttachment) {
161 $attachment['title'] = $record['level_name'];
162 $attachment['text'] = $message;
163 } else {
164 $attachment['title'] = 'Message';
165 $attachment['text'] = $message;
166 $attachment['fields'][] = array(
167 'title' => 'Level',
168 'value' => $record['level_name'],
169 'short' => true,
170 );
171 }
172
173 if ($this->includeContextAndExtra) {
174 if (!empty($record['extra'])) {
175 if ($this->useShortAttachment) {
176 $attachment['fields'][] = array(
177 'title' => "Extra",
178 'value' => $this->stringify($record['extra']),
179 'short' => $this->useShortAttachment,
180 );
181 } else {
182 // Add all extra fields as individual fields in attachment
183 foreach ($record['extra'] as $var => $val) {
184 $attachment['fields'][] = array(
185 'title' => $var,
186 'value' => $val,
187 'short' => $this->useShortAttachment,
188 );
189 }
190 }
191 }
192
193 if (!empty($record['context'])) {
194 if ($this->useShortAttachment) {
195 $attachment['fields'][] = array(
196 'title' => "Context",
197 'value' => $this->stringify($record['context']),
198 'short' => $this->useShortAttachment,
199 );
200 } else {
201 // Add all context fields as individual fields in attachment
202 foreach ($record['context'] as $var => $val) {
203 $attachment['fields'][] = array(
204 'title' => $var,
205 'value' => $val,
206 'short' => $this->useShortAttachment,
207 );
208 }
209 }
210 }
211 }
212
213 $dataArray['attachments'] = json_encode(array($attachment));
214 } else {
215 $dataArray['text'] = $message;
216 }
217
218 if ($this->iconEmoji) {
219 $dataArray['icon_emoji'] = ":{$this->iconEmoji}:";
220 }
221
222 return $dataArray;
223 }
